Спецификации

Атрибут Ценность
Package Tape & Reel (TR),Cut Tape (CT)
ProductStatus Active
Type General Purpose
NumberofElements 1
OutputType Open Collector
Voltage-SupplySingle/Dual(±) 2.7V ~ 5.5V
Voltage-InputOffset(Max) 7mV @ 5V
Current-InputBias(Max) 0.25µA @ 5V
Current-Output(Typ) 84mA @ 5V
Current-Quiescent(Max) 120µA
PropagationDelay(Max) 450ns
OperatingTemperature -40°C ~ 125°C
Package/Case 5-TSSOP, SC-70-5, SOT-353
MountingType Surface Mount

Description

The LMV331SE-7 is a general-purpose, low-power voltage comparator designed for a wide range of applications. It operates with a single supply voltage, usually between 2.7V and 5.5V, making it suitable for battery-powered devices and portable electronics. The device features a low input offset voltage and low input bias current, which enhance its performance in precision applications. It offers an open-drain output, allowing it to interface with various logic levels or be configured with a pull-up resistor for a specific voltage level.
This comparator is known for its fast response time, enabling quick decision-making in circuit designs. It is often used in applications like signal detection, zero-crossing detectors, and as a basic building block in analog-to-digital conversion systems. Application

The LMV331SE-7 is a general-purpose, low-voltage comparator. Its application areas include:
1. Voltage Level Detection: Used in circuits to detect when a signal crosses a certain threshold, enabling power management and control systems.
2. Sensor Interface: Converts analog sensor signals into digital outputs for processing.
3. Zero-Crossing Detection: Utilized in AC applications to detect zero-crossing points for phase control or motor control systems.
4. Oscillators and Timers: Forms basic oscillators for timing and pulse generation applications.
5. Signal Conditioning: Enhances signal quality in measurement and instrumentation systems.
6. Battery-Powered Devices: Suitable for low-power applications due to its low voltage operation.
